| | 6. | | American Rescue Plan Act (ARPA) Mayor’s Phase I: Stronger Summer Proposal
a. Presentation by Aaron Szopinski, Policy Director – Mayor’s Office
b. Questions
| | | |
|
Not available
|
| | | | Aaron Szopinski presented an overview of Mayor Barrett’s Stronger Summer plan to allocate $93 million of the ARPA funds to address immediate needs including public health & the pandemic response, affordable housing, and violence prevention, with plans for investment in lead abatement activities in the fall. | | | |

| | 10. | | Lead Program
a. Updates, communications update and timeline
b. Questions
| | | |
|
Not available
|
| | | | Deputy Commissioner Weber presented an update on the Lead Program. Current activities include the audit from the Public Health Foundation, engagement with DHS’ quality and program improvement, DER and exploring options to reduce EBLL intervention levels. | | | |
